Dog Bandanas

Filter and sort
Filter and sort

18 products

Product type
Brand
Price
  • The highest price is $16.95
Availability

18 products

18 products

Clear
Product type
Brand
Price
The highest price is $16.95 Reset
Availability

$9.95

$14.95

Sold out

$9.95

$9.95

$14.95

$14.95

$14.95

Sold out

$9.95

$9.95

Sold out

$9.95

Sold out

$9.95

$9.95

$9.95

$9.95

$9.95

$9.00